On Tue, Jul 29, 2025 at 04:22:43PM +0000, Uros Stajic wrote:
> From: Chao-ying Fu <cfu@mips.com>
> 
> Add a GPIO driver for the Intel EG20T Platform Controller Hub, which
> exposes a set of 12 GPIOs via PCI MMIO.
> 
> The driver implements basic GPIO operations (input/output direction,
> value read/write, and function query) using the U-Boot driver model
> infrastructure. It maps the required BAR1 region via `dm_pci_map_bar`
> and uses internal registers to control pin state and direction.
> 
> This driver is required for platforms using EG20T, such as P8700-based
> systems, to access GPIOs through the standard U-Boot DM GPIO framework.

> diff --git a/drivers/gpio/eg20t-gpio.c b/drivers/gpio/eg20t-gpio.c
> new file mode 100644
> index 00000000000..d41ca4bfb17
> --- /dev/null
> +++ b/drivers/gpio/eg20t-gpio.c
> @@ -0,0 +1,138 @@
> +// SPDX-License-Identifier: GPL-2.0+
> +/*
> + * Copyright (C) 2016 Imagination Technologies
> + */
> +
> +#include <dm.h>
> +#include <errno.h>
> +#include <pci.h>
> +#include <asm/io.h>
> +#include <asm/gpio.h>
> +#include <log.h>
> +
> +enum {
> +	REG_IEN		= 0x00,
> +	REG_ISTATUS	= 0x04,
> +	REG_IDISP	= 0x08,
> +	REG_ICLR	= 0x0c,
> +	REG_IMASK	= 0x10,
> +	REG_IMASKCLR	= 0x14,
> +	REG_PO		= 0x18,
> +	REG_PI		= 0x1c,
> +	REG_PM		= 0x20,
> +};
> +
> +struct eg20t_gpio_priv {
> +	void *base;
> +};
> +
> +static int eg20t_gpio_get_value(struct udevice *dev, unsigned int offset)
> +{
> +	struct eg20t_gpio_priv *priv = dev_get_priv(dev);
> +	u32 pm, pval;
> +
> +	pm = readl(priv->base + REG_PM);
> +	if ((pm >> offset) & 0x1)
> +		pval = readl(priv->base + REG_PO);
> +	else
> +		pval = readl(priv->base + REG_PI);
> +
> +	return (pval >> offset) & 0x1;
> +}
> +
> +static int eg20t_gpio_set_value(struct udevice *dev, unsigned int offset,
> +				int value)
> +{
> +	struct eg20t_gpio_priv *priv = dev_get_priv(dev);
> +	u32 po;
> +
> +	po = readl(priv->base + REG_PO);
> +	if (value)
> +		po |= 1 << offset;
> +	else
> +		po &= ~(1 << offset);
> +	writel(po, priv->base + REG_PO);
> +	return 0;
> +}

This file contains inconsistent usage of empty lines between statements
and the final return among functions. I think it's better to keep the
style aligned.

Regards,
Yao Zi
